After half a year we proud to release this new beta version of Ferdi with tons of new features, bug fixes and 24 new services.
Due to problems with our Apple certificate, this release is unsigned on macOS. What does this mean to you? Due to this, you will have to manually update to this version on macOS by downloading the release below and installing it normally. If you are having problems opening the installer, please follow https://support.apple.com/guide/mac-help/mh40616/mac.
Install
Use these Links to quickly download the right file for your OS:
Download Ferdi 5.6.0-beta.5 for:
Download Ferdi-5.6.0-beta.5.AppImage, ferdi-5.6.0-beta.5.tar.gz, ferdi-5.6.0-beta.5.x86_64.rpm or ferdi_5.6.0-beta.5_amd64.deb below for Linux.
What's new?
Features
- Add FAB to service dashboard (#824)
- Add "Go to Home Page" in services context menu (#900)
💖 @raicerk - Add vertical style and "Always show workspace drawer" setting (#567)
- Flash TaskBar (Windows) / Bounce Dock (Mac) on New Message (#1020)
💖 @mahadevans87 - Add danish translations
💖 @madsmtm
Minor changes
- Update dependencies
- Add Norwegian translations (#840)
💖 @larsmagnusherland - Update adaptable dark mode to work on all platforms (#834)
- Improved onboarding flow and settings empty states (#996)
💖 @tofran - Enhance the "Support Ferdi" screen (#722)
💖 @yourcontact - Improve Ferdi's design (#977)
Recipes
-
Add 24 new recipes! Nextcloud, Nextcloud Cospend, Nextcloud Tasks, StackExchange, Noisli, Yahoo Mail, TickTick, DevDocs, Figma, iCloud Reminders, OneNote, YouTrack, SimpleNote, Lark, Slite, Pinterest, Disqus, Microsoft Todo, Google Podcasts, YouTube Music, Sync.com, Wire, Fleep, Google Classroom
💖 @eandersons, @kittywhiskers, @andrsussa, @vraravam, @arioki1, @hongshaoyang, @tofran, @stephenpapierski, @marcolussetti, @alopix, @iansearly, @TanZng -
Fix connection error in case of audio/video call in Google Meet (getferdi/recipes#186)
💖 @Room4O4 -
Fix Wrike notification counter (getferdi/recipes#237)
💖 @mvdgun -
Update recipe for element (getferdi/recipes#247)
💖 @fjl5 -
Add support for empty unread badges in WhatsApp (getferdi/recipes#236)
💖 @ruippeixotog -
Add custom URLs for Jira (getferdi/recipes#217)
💖 @yann-soubeyrand -
Fixing unread-counter for office365 (getferdi/recipes#229)
💖 @CrEaK -
Mattermost: Fix badge for unread channels when in single team (getferdi/recipes#230)
💖 @CrEaK -
Update Riot.im to Element.io (getferdi/recipes#235)
💖 @omove -
Fix whatsapp fullscreen for different screen sizes (getferdi/recipes#216)
💖 @breuerfelix -
Changed gmail getMessages to grab value next to Inbox
💖 @stephenpapierski -
Fix Gmail getMessages produces wrong value
💖 @stephenpapierski -
Update Hangouts Chat to display direct and indirect notifications (#306)
💖 @mahadevans87 -
Update user agent for OWA and Outlook (#302)
💖 @StormPooper -
Updated Zoho icons
💖 @tofran -
Spoof Chrome plugins for Skype
💖 @kris7t -
More careful Gmail unread count detection
💖 @kris7t -
Update Todoist notifications badge selector (#333) (#334)
💖 @rvisharma -
Fix messages count for Fastmail (#335) (#336)
💖 @marcolussetti -
Fix Zoho Mail
💖 @pointergr -
Add notification count for Habitica
💖 @iansearly
Fixes
- Fix Electron 9 crash on Windows 10 (#986)
💖 @mahadevans87 - Patch getDisplayMedia for screen sharing in all services (#802)
- Fix "Open folder" button on "Custom services" screen (#991)
Under the hood
Assets
15
vantezzen
released this
Features
Minor changes
- Update node-sass to 4.14.0 for compatibility with Node 14.x (#656)
💖 @dpeukert - Change Keyboard shortcut tooltip text in Sidebar for Settings (#665)
💖 @sampathBlam - Restore "delete service" option in sidebar (#692)
💖 @sampathBlam - Add Google Tasks to Todo providers (#695)
💖 @dannyqiu - Restore window last closed maximize/fullscreen state (#733)
💖 @dannyqiu - Add password hashing to lock password (#694)
- Close/open window when clicking on tray menu item (#630)
💖 @dandelionadia - Use Tray popUpContextMenu on macOS/Windows only (#741)
- Setup nightly releases deployment pipeline (#730)
- Make Tray icons more robust on Linux (#748)
💖 @kris7t - Load disable hibernation per service status on startup (#754)
💖 @kris7t - Update global user agent to conform with spec (#779)
💖 @dannyqiu
Bug Fixes
- Prevent unnecessary electron popup windows for links (#685)
💖 @mahadevans87 - Refactor locking feature (#693)
- Review launch on startup for macOS, start Ferdi app, not renderer (#696)
💖 @dannyqiu - Fix TodosWebview user agent (#713)
💖 @mahadevans87 - Fix crash when using Password Lock with TouchID API unavailable (#737)
💖 @mahadevans87 - Fix setting of webview disablewebsecurity attribute (#772)
💖 @dannyqiu
Assets
15
This release got replaced by 5.6.0-beta.2 due to problems with our building infrastructure.
Assets
2
kytwb
released this
Features
- Merge Franz 5.5.0-beta.2
- Add modifyRequestHeaders, enable properly setting headers for services (#639),
💖 @mahadevans87 @sampathBlam - Add dropdown list to choose Todo service (#418, #477),
💖 @yourcontact - Add hotkey for darkmode (#530, #537),
💖 @Room4O4 & @mahadevans87 - Add option to start Ferdi minimized (#490, #534)
- Add option to show draggable window area on macOS (#304, #532)
- Add support for Adaptable Dark Mode on Windows (#548),
💖 @Room4O4 & @mahadevans87 - Add notification & audio toggle action in tray context menu (#542),
💖 @Room4O4 & @mahadevans87 - Add Dark Reader settings (#531, #568),
💖 @Room4O4 & @mahadevans87 - Add support for 11 new services and improve existing ones,
💖 @rctneil @JakeSteam @sampathBlam @tpopela @RoiArthurB - Add support for unlocking with Touch ID (#367)
- Add find in page feature (#67) (#432)
- Add custom dark mode handler support (#445)
- Add option to disable reload after resume (#442),
💖 @n0emis - Add custom JS/CSS to services (#83)
- Add ability to change the services icons size and sidebar width (#153)
- Differentiate between indirect and direct notifications (#590),
💖 @Room4O4 @mahadevans87 @FeikoJoosten @sampathBlam - Add setting to keep service in hibernation after startup (#577, #584)
Minor changes
- Improve user onboarding (#493)
- Improve "Updates" section in settings (#506),
💖 @yourcontact - Improve information about Franz Premium and Teams
- Hide user lastname on Ferdi servers as it is not stored
- Improve draggable window area height for macOS (#304, #479)
- Remove server setting from settings screen (#516),
💖 @mrassili - Update Electron to 8.1.1 (#480)
- Window title now reflects service name (#213),
💖 @gmarec - Improve system tray icon behaviour (#307)
- Improve navigation bar behaviour setting (#270)
- Ferdi is now available as Flatpak on Flathub (#323),
💖 @lhw - Add automatic local recipe updates
- Add option to start Ferdi in system tray (#331),
💖 @jereksel - Add better support for macOS dark mode
- Add better seperation in settings
- Change Sentry telemetry to be opt-in only (#160)
- Remove excess code from Franz's hibernate feature (#609)
- Refocus Webview only for active service (#610),
💖 @Room4O4 & @mahadevans87 - Use GitHub notifications center and direct notifications (getferdi/recipes#133)
- Switch back to original Telegram, add Telegram React (getferdi/recipes#132)
- Fix notifications for various services,
💖 @FeikoJoosten - Add support for indirect messages for various services,
💖 @FeikoJoosten - Use correct Riot icon (getferdi/recipes#125),
💖 @halms - Remove incorrectly placed icons (getferdi/recipes#126),
💖 @halms - Fix slack draft notifications (getferdi/recipes#127),
💖 @Serubin - Remove automatic reloading from WhatsApp
- Update Microsoft Teams to allow Desktop Sharing (getferdi/recipes#116),
💖 @Gautasmi - Organize settings with horizontal tabs (#569),
💖 @yourcontact - Improve cache clearing UI feedback (#620),
💖 @saruwman
Bug fixes
- Fix cache clearing not working in Windows 10 (#541, #544),
💖 @Room4O4 & @mahadevans87 - Fix Home button in navigation bar not correctly navigating (#571, #573),
💖 @Room4O4 & @mahadevans87 - Fix and enhance context menu (#357) (#413) (#452) (#354) (#227)
- Fix regresssion around muting services (#428),
💖 @dpeukert - Fix app unusable without an account on Windows since v5.4.0 (#253)
- Fix services URL validation/harmonization (#276)
- Fix app failing to properly lock itself at startup resulting in shortcuts not working (#377) (#362)
- Fix shortcuts not working when locked (#404)
- Fix missing Slack services custom icons (#290)
- Fix app possibly unusable when using faulty translations (#340)
- Fix Dark Mode setting on Windows (#347)
- Fix login problems in Google services
- Fix Dark Reader blocking services from loading (#285)
- Fix incorrect body closing tag (#330),
💖 @jereksel - Fix DarkReader translation problem (#593)
Build changes
Assets
15
FerdiBot
released this
Features
- Differentiate between indirect and direct notifications (#590),
💖 @Room4O4 @mahadevans87 @FeikoJoosten @sampathBlam - Add setting to keep service in hibernation after startup (#577, #584)
Minor changes
- Update Electron to 8.2.3
- Remove excess code from Franz's hibernate feature (#609)
- Refocus Webview only for active service (#610),
💖 @Room4O4 & @mahadevans87 - Use GitHub notifications center and direct notifications (getferdi/recipes#133)
- Switch back to original Telegram, add Telegram React (getferdi/recipes#132)
- Fix notifications for various services,
💖 @FeikoJoosten - Add support for indirect messages for various services,
💖 @FeikoJoosten - Use correct Riot icon (getferdi/recipes#125),
💖 @halms - Remove incorrectly placed icons (getferdi/recipes#126),
💖 @halms - Fix slack draft notifications (getferdi/recipes#127),
💖 @Serubin - Remove automatic reloading from WhatsApp
- Update Microsoft Teams to allow Desktop Sharing (getferdi/recipes#116),
💖 @Gautasmi - Organize settings with horizontal tabs (#569),
💖 @yourcontact - Improve cache clearing UI feedback (#620),
💖 @saruwman
Assets
15
FerdiBot
released this
Features
- Merge Franz 5.5.0-beta.2 #264
- Add dropdown list to choose Todo service (#418, #477),
💖 @yourcontact - Add hotkey for darkmode (#530, #537),
💖 @Room4O4 & @mahadevans87 - Add option to start Ferdi minimized (#490, #534)
- Add option to show draggable window area on macOS (#304, #532)
- Add support for Adaptable Dark Mode on Windows (#548),
💖 @Room4O4 & @mahadevans87 - Add notification & audio toggle action in tray context menu (#542),
💖 @Room4O4 & @mahadevans87 - Add Dark Reader settings (#531, #568),
💖 @Room4O4 & @mahadevans87 - Add support for 11 new services and improve existing ones,
💖 @rctneil @JakeSteam @sampathBlam @tpopela @RoiArthurB
Minor changes
- Improve user onboarding (#493)
- Improve "Updates" section in settings (#506),
💖 @yourcontact - Improve information about Franz Premium and Teams
- Improve user scripts (#559)
- Hide user lastname on Ferdi servers as it is not stored
- Improve draggable window area height for macOS (#304, #479)
- Remove server setting from settings screen (#516),
💖 @mrassili - Update Electron to 8.1.1 (#480)
Bug fixes
- Fix cache clearing not working in Windows 10 (#541, #544),
💖 @Room4O4 & @mahadevans87 - Fix Home button in navigation bar not correctly navigating (#571, #573),
💖 @Room4O4 & @mahadevans87
Build changes
Assets
15
FerdiBot
released this
- Add support for unlocking with Touch ID #367
- Add find in page feature #67 #432
- Add custom dark mode handler support #445
- Add option to disable reload after resume #442
- Fix and enhance context menu #357 #413 #452 #354 #227
- Fix regresssion around muting services #428
- Window title now reflects service name #213
Assets
15
FerdiBot
released this
- Fix app unusable without an account on Windows since v5.4.0 #253
- Upgrade to Electron 8 #369
- Ferdi is now available as Flatpak on Flathub #323
- Add custom JS/CSS to services #83
- Add ability to change the services icons size and sidebar width #153
- Enhance system tray icon behaviour #307
- Enhance navigation bar behaviour setting #270
- Fix services URL validation/harmonization #276
- Fix app failing to properly lock itself at startup resulting in shortcuts not working #377 #362
- Fix shortcuts not working when locked #404
- Fix missing Slack services custom icons #290
- Fix app possibly unusable when using faulty translations #340
- Fix Dark Mode setting on Windows #347